Rita's family was her life. She thoroughly enjoyed the midday meals that her daughter Linda would cook, family members coming by to eat, spending time with her and listening to her many funny stories of when she was growing up in Statenville. She was extremely smart, witty and had a better long-term memory than any of her children. She was a Christian and a member of Southside Baptist Church for many years. She was unable to attend church the last few years due to her hearing loss but loved the Lord.
She is survived by 1 sister, Lillian McAdams of Douglasville, GA, 4 children, Don (Sheron) Hogan, Linda (Bobby-deceased) Stamper, Diane Coker, all of Lake City, FL and Paula (Steve) Mitchell of Sellersburg, Indiana; grandchildren, Jason Hogan, Jaime (Danny) Weber, David Stamper, Chris (Jamie) Stamper, Veronica Martin, Jim Coker, Wendy Pillars, Tara Townsend, Renee Mitchell, Shawn Mitchell and Shane (Tanya) Mitchell. Also surviving are 21 great grandchildren, 8 great-great grandchildren and loving nieces and nephews, many of whom thought of her as their second mother.
